Dunkirk is a census-designated place (CDP) in Calvert County, Maryland, United States. The population was 2,521 at the 2010 census.
Dunkirk is located in northwestern Calvert County at 38°42′49″N 76°40′12″W / 38.71361°N 76.67000°W (38.713499, −76.670070). Its western affix is the Patuxent River, which is after that the Prince George’s County line. Maryland Route 4 passes through the center of Dunkirk, leading northwest 10 miles (16 km) to Upper Marlboro and south 14 miles (23 km) to Prince Frederick, the Calvert County seat. Downtown Washington, D.C., is 25 miles (40 km) to the northwest.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the Dunkirk CDP has a total Place of 7.3 square miles (19.0 km), of which 6.6 square miles (17.1 km2) is house and 0.73 square miles (1.9 km), or 10.21%, is water.
The climate in this area is characterized by hot, humid summers and generally mild to cool winters. According to the Köppen Climate Classification system, Dunkirk has a humid subtropical climate, abbreviated “Cfa” on climate maps.
